Last summer I spent 5 weeks in the Dominican Republic with ISV and it was by far the best 5 weeks of my life! I wish I could find the words to express the ways in which this trip has changed me but I guess that’s up to you to experience for yourself. I tell everyone that I think this trip was the best way to travel the island in 5 weeks. You get to experience almost every side of life. The first week you stay with a wonderful host family which allows you to get a glimpse into the everyday life of what I would consider your average middle-class family in the Dominican Republic. Then the next two weeks doing volunteer work you get a glimpse of the more poverty stricken areas and the places and ways these people live which makes you truly appreciate the things we take for granted on a day-to-day basis. Some of the volunteer work we did included interacting with the children in the community, creating cement floors in houses that previously had dirt floors, building several latrines and a community center. The volunteer work itself was so rewarding! The work was definitely physical; I was sore after the first day of shoveling but I also found my passion for cement mixing. Then during the adventure tour you push yourself past your comfort zone during various activities surrounded by beautiful scenery. You also travel basically around the entire island moving from hotel to hotel every 2-3 days. I was expecting to stay in cheap motels, but we stayed in BEAUTIFUL hotels that far exceeded my expectations. From the hotels you take day trips to other areas with beautiful scenery. Some of the activities we did during these two weeks included white-water rafting, surfing, cliff jumping, snorkeling, wind-surfing and swimming in beautiful clear water. I spent my first two weeks at Waterfall Springs which is a gorgeous organization that focuses on the breeding and release of the Brush Tailed Rock Wallaby which is an endangered species. My group members, who soon became like family, and I worked tirelessly to clean up their enclosures and make Waterfall Springs more professional for future donators. The second two weeks were spent traveling around Australia doing once in a life time activities while learning about the importance of ecotourism. I was able to sky dive, bungy jump, scuba dive, and so much more. My project leader and tour leader were so knowledgeable and fun to be around. I left Australia wishing I never had to leave.
